American Crew Daily Moisturizing Conditioner vs Curl Keeper Curl Clouds - Calming Conditioner
While both Curl Keeper Curl Clouds - Calming Conditioner and American Crew Daily Moisturizing Conditioner aim to hydrate and soften hair, they cater to different hair care philosophies. Curl Keeper focuses on calming frizz and enhancing curl definition, making it ideal for curly hair types. On the other hand, American Crew is designed for daily use across various hair types, emphasizing moisture and manageability. Ingredient overlap exists, yet the overall formulation and intended use differ, suggesting that users may prefer one over the other based on their specific hair needs.

CETEARYL ALCOHOL
Emollient Skin Conditioner, Emulsifying Surfactant, Emulsion Stabilizer, Foam-Boosting Surfactant, Opacifying Agent, Cleansing Surfactant, Viscosity Controller · Shared
CETEARYL ALCOHOL is a fatty alcohol commonly used in cosmetic formulations for its multifunctional properties. It serves as a skin-conditioning emollient, helping to soften and smooth the skin. Additionally, it acts as a surfactant and emulsifier, stabilizing mixtures of water and oils, which is crucial for creating consistent and effective products. Its ability to boost foam and control viscosity makes it valuable in various formulations, contributing to the texture and application of creams, lotions, and cleansers. Overall, formulators may add CETEARYL ALCOHOL to enhance product performance and improve the sensory experience for users.
Glycerin
Denaturant, Hair Conditioner, Humectant, Oral Care, Skin Protectant, Solvent, Viscosity Controller, Perfuming Agent, Fragrance, Humectant Skin Conditioner · Shared
Glycerin, also known as Glycerine, is a naturally occurring compound that serves primarily as a humectant in cosmetic formulations. This means it has the ability to attract moisture from the environment and bind it to the skin, helping to maintain hydration levels. Due to its effective moisturizing properties, formulators often include Glycerin in products to enhance skin softness and elasticity, making it a popular choice in various skincare and cosmetic formulations.
BEHENTRIMONIUM CHLORIDE
Antistatic, Hair Conditioner, Preservative · Shared
BEHENTRIMONIUM CHLORIDE is a cosmetic ingredient that serves multiple functions, including antistatic, hair-conditioning, and preservative properties. As an antistatic agent, it helps reduce static electricity in hair, making it easier to manage and style. Its hair-conditioning function contributes to improving the texture and feel of hair, enhancing its overall appearance. Additionally, as a preservative, it aids in maintaining the stability and longevity of cosmetic formulations by preventing microbial growth. Formulators may add BEHENTRIMONIUM CHLORIDE to products to achieve these beneficial effects, ensuring a better user experience and product efficacy.

ISOPROPYL MYRISTATE
Binding Agent, Emollient Skin Conditioner, Fragrance, Perfuming Agent · Shared
ISOPROPYL MYRISTATE is an ester of isopropyl alcohol and myristic acid, commonly used in cosmetics for its emollient properties. It functions as a skin-conditioning agent, helping to soften and smooth the skin, while also serving as a binding agent that can enhance the texture and feel of formulations. Additionally, it is often utilized in fragrance and perfuming applications, contributing to the overall sensory experience of a product. Formulators may add ISOPROPYL MYRISTATE to improve the spreadability of products and to create a more luxurious feel on the skin.
Caprylyl Glycol
Deodorant, Emollient Skin Conditioner, Hair Conditioner, Skin Conditioner, Preservative, Humectant · Shared
Caprylyl Glycol is a multifunctional ingredient commonly used in cosmetics for its preservative and humectant properties. As a preservative, it helps to inhibit the growth of microorganisms, thereby extending the shelf life of cosmetic products. Its humectant function allows it to attract and retain moisture in the skin, contributing to hydration and a smoother appearance. Formulators may add Caprylyl Glycol to enhance product stability and improve the overall sensory experience of the formulation.
